Helen got a 7% reduction in the price of a pair jeans that are normally $32. What is the approximate percent in the price?
adoni [48]

A percentage is a way to describe a part of a whole. The approximate percent decrease in the price is 21.87%, thus, the correct option is B.

<h3>What are Percentages?</h3>

A percentage is a way to describe a part of a whole. such as the fraction ¼ can be described as 0.25 which is equal to 25%.

To convert a fraction to a percentage, convert the fraction to decimal form and then multiply by 100 with the '%' symbol.

Given the reduction in the price is $7, while the original cost is $32. Therefore, the approximate percent decrease in the price is,

Percentage decrease = 7/32  × 100%

                                     = 21.87%

Hence, the approximate percent decrease in the price is 21.87%, thus, the correct option is B.

The correct question is:

Helen got a $7 reduction in the price of a pair of jeans that are normally $32. What is the approximate percent decrease in the price?

The percent decrease is approximately 15%.

The percent decrease is approximately 21%.

The percent decrease is approximately 43%.

The percent decrease is approximately 78%

Assume that blood pressure readings are normally distributed with a mean of 124 and a standard deviation of 6.4. If 64 people ar
Murrr4er [49]

Answer:

99.38%

Step-by-step explanation:

We have that the mean (m) is equal to 124, the standard deviation (sd) 6.4 and the sample size (n) = 64

They ask us for P (x <126)

For this, the first thing is to calculate z, which is given by the following equation:

z = (x - m) / (sd / (n ^ 1/2))

We have all these values, replacing we have:

z = (126 - 124) / (6.4 / (64 ^ 1/2))

z = 2.5

With the normal distribution table (attached), we have that at that value, the probability is:

P (z <2.5) = 0.9938

The probability is 99.38%
